This is the second of my Winter projects..the first was the Mod Squad Mercury Wagon. WIP

The Desoto was missing a few parts, so I dug into the parts box & used the radiator cradle & firewall from an AMT 70 Dodge, the engine was built from 3 different Mopar kits, wheels & tires are Pegasus.

Paint is Tamiya TS 54, Light Metallic Blue.  Comments welcome.
